Quebec business owners have requested the government of the province to improve immigration instantly to support to reduce chronic labor shortage.
Quebec Employers Council says higher number of immigrants is required to avoid slowing the economy of Quebec Province.
Quebec's historic low rate of unemployment 4.9% is symbolic of the employers' struggle that they are facing with finding the correct people to fill openings.
However, the government of the Quebec province, the Coalition Avenir Quebec, intends to decrease immigration by 20% to about 40,000 immigrants in 2019, with small yearly increases after that.
The CAQ argued that a drop in immigration was required to enable the overhaul of the province's immigration system for integrating current immigrants.
It started in August the latest integration program named the 'Personalized Career Pathway.' Immigrants will get support from the Quebec immigration ministry (MIDI) officers from prior to their arrival, to immediately integrate them into the Quebec community and labor market.
However, companies are stating they want people more instantly to promote their businesses growth.
CAQ discussions are taking place in the current week to hear from stakeholders on its plan of immigration between 2019 and 2022.
Council figures reveal there are presently 120,000 unfilled jobs in the province of Quebec at all skilled levels. As the median age of the Quebec population rises, the shortage is assumed to become more critical.
The CAQ's policy of immigration has been a source of debate ever since the party got power last year.
After publishing the decreased levels of immigration, it then moved to improve the system of skilled migration, and in the process canceling plenty of appeals that were in the backlog.
The latest Expression of Interest system, which runs by the Arrima portal, which works similar to the Canadian Express Entry system. Applicants first provide a profile to an Expression of Interest Bank, and the top-scoring profiles chosen and announced with an invitation to appeal for Quebec immigration.
